Proposed Rule Addresses Adjuster Licensing Requirements

Tuesday, February 19, 2019 | 0

The New Mexico Superintendent of Insurance has proposed a rule regarding licensing requirements for public, independent and staff insurance adjusters in the state. Under the proposed rule, licensure would be required for insurance adjusters investigating or settling claims in New Mexico. The rule would require adjusters working on comp claims for claimants in New Mexico to be licensed. Each workers’ comp insurer would be required to have at least one claims representative within the state, licensed as an adjuster, to pay claims.
